Yeah we all know the joke but B20 is important - maybe less so at this price level but I would go out of my way to have it now I’ve had it. I would hate to have no signal at any given time and always have in the back of my mind: ‘is this because there is genuinely no signal or because I cheaped out and bought a phone without full coverage’. By all means settle for a slower SoC or less RAM but when it comes to signal that’s number one for me

Because there will be places that have 4G on band 20 only and no other signal. You don’t always have 3G automatically where there is no 4G, not even 2G sometimes - we have this situation near our offices in Whiteley, there was a 4G mast erected but 2G and 3G were provided by cells much further out.
I am well aware of how fast 3G can be in theory.

I think you would need to consider more than just the processor and memory sizes. The Redmi Note 5A is a larger 5.5" phone, hence 'Note'. The higher model is like a larger Redmi 4X but with 1000mah less battery and the screen won't be as sharp (larger screen, same 720p res). The lower model is like a larger Redmi 4A. The only improved feature is the separate dedicated microSD and better front camera+flash on the higher model but besides that, I don't think they fit well in terms of price and spec, compared to the other current Redmi phones.
